Solvent-free synthesis of δ-carbolines/carbazoles from 3-nitro-2-phenylpyridines/2-nitrobiphenyl derivatives using DPPE as a reducing agent
Peng, Haixia,Chen, Xuxing,Chen, Yanhong,He, Qian,Xie, Yuyuan,Yang, Chunhao
, p. 5725 - 5731 (2011)
A green and efficient preparation of functionalized δ-carbolines/ carbazoles via reductive ring closure by 1,2-bis(dipenylphosphino)ethane under solvent-free conditions is described. The starting materials 3-nitro-2-phenylpyridines/2-nitrobiphenyl derivatives are readily prepared through Suzuki-Miyaura cross-coupling reaction from commercially available compounds. And the polar by-product ethane-1,2-diylbis(diphenylphosphine oxide) is easily removed from the relatively polar reaction mixture. Various substituted δ-carbolines/carbazoles are obtained in acceptable yields. It is particularly worth mentioning that substrates with electron-withdrawing groups (EWG) also give the desired products in good yield.
